Can colour-blind study medicine, SC asks panel

Source:- deccanherald.com The Supreme Court has directed the Medical Council of India to form a committee of experts to examine the possibility of colour-blind people pursuing the MBBS course. Monsanto loses legal battle with Indian seed producer

Source:- reuters.com Monsanto lost a legal battle with one of India’s biggest seed producers over a contract dispute on Tuesday, and was ordered to restore a licensing agreement and cut royalty charges.
